I still like Korean Drama, but sometimes I think it just a drama, not a reality . How coincidence would be - the couple broke up, after five year, the girl come back to Korea, and got the job that ex-boy friend work on. the brother dating this ex-boy friend's niece. Now they back together, found out he is (step) mom's nephew, boy friend's sister actually is her mom's long lost child from first marriage. The world is pretty small in Korean soap.
But in a way, this is so close to real life. Bit ch mother in law do exceed. wimpy boy friend do exceed. Just in Korean soap, sometimes it turn out happy ending, but real life is not as easy as the tv drama

Although these dramas take place in Seoul, they all seem to exist in a very small town, where people work,shop, and dine in the same places. They constantly run into each other and the families are often inter-related. This small town feel and its emphasis on family is one reason I usually like the dramas. I also sometimes feel the writers could be more creative and logical when using this small town stage.
